The Working Principle of CNC Plastic Cutting Machines:

At the core of CNC plastic cutting machines lies their incredible precision and automation. These machines utilize computer-controlled programs to guide the cutting tools and create complex shapes from plastic materials. The program dictates the machine's movements, ensuring consistency and accuracy down to the micro-level. High-quality CNC plastic cutting machines are equipped with advanced sensors, real-time monitoring, and automatic tool changers, further enhancing their performance and efficiency.

Benefits of CNC Plastic Cutting Machines:

1. Precision and Accuracy: CNC plastic cutting machines offer unparalleled precision, allowing manufacturers to create intricate shapes with tight tolerances. The automated process eliminates human error and ensures consistent results, reducing the need for extensive quality control measures.

2. Increased Efficiency: With CNC plastic cutting machines, manufacturers can significantly improve production efficiency. These machines operate continuously, working at high speeds while maintaining accuracy, eliminating the need for manual labor-intensive processes. Consequently, production times are reduced, and overall productivity is enhanced.

3. Versatility: CNC plastic cutting machines can work with a wide range of plastic materials, including acrylic, polycarbonate, PVC, and more. This flexibility enables manufacturers to create diverse products, from delicate medical devices to rugged industrial components, all with exceptional precision.

4. Waste Reduction: In traditional plastic cutting methods, significant amounts of material are wasted due to imprecise cuts and errors. CNC machines optimize material usage by maximizing efficiency, minimizing waste, and ultimately reducing costs.

The Impact of CNC Plastic Cutting Machines on the Manufacturing Industry:

The integration of CNC plastic cutting machines has had a profound impact on the manufacturing industry. Here are some key points:

1. Streamlined Production Processes: CNC machines have streamlined the plastic cutting process, providing a faster and more cost-effective way to produce complex plastic components. Manufacturers can now meet strict deadlines and increase their output without compromising on quality.

2. Improved Product Quality: The precision and accuracy of CNC plastic cutting machines have elevated the quality of plastic components. This has resulted in reduced product defects, increased customer satisfaction, and strengthened brand reputation.

3. Cost Savings: While CNC plastic cutting machines require an initial investment, the long-term benefits outweigh the costs. Manufacturers can achieve cost savings through reduced labor costs, improved material utilization, and minimized rework due to fewer errors.

4. Job Creation: The integration of CNC plastic cutting machines has not replaced human workers but has instead shifted their roles. Skilled operators are needed to program, operate, and maintain these machines, creating new job opportunities and advancing technological expertise within the industry.
